Key Fobs

Key fobs can also be referred to as proximity keys or smart keys. They come with security chips inside which send signals to vehicles which open its doors or starts it. They are available in two forms: key fobs, which attach to a keychain and have buttons that perform various functions and combo keys which are all one unit.

If your device doesn't function properly, it could be that the battery must be replaced. It's simple to replace the battery at a big-box retailer or hardware store. The car owner's manual (or an online search) will give you the correct instructions specific to your model.

Key fobs which lose power are among the most frequent issues. This means that you can't use the remote keyless entry feature to lock your vehicle or open it. happy-african-american-businessman-holding-car-key-2022-12-16-16-36-17-utc-min-scaled.jpgTransponder Keys

Transponder keys add an extra layer of security to any vehicle. These keys have a RFID microchip that sends out a digital signal when inserted into the ignition. If the immobilizer recognizes the digital ID, it will release and allow the car to start. This will stop hot-wiring as well as other methods of stealing cars. They're not foolproof, and criminals have found ways to get around them. It is essential to keep a spare.

Some transponder keys have a fixed code, while others such as those manufactured by GM have a rolling that changes the code every time the keys are used. This means that no one can duplicate your key and use it to start your car as the code changing is updated each time the key is used.

Keys with transponders are more expensive to replace, but they also provide an additional layer of security that could protect your car from theft.
